As reported by the Wall Street Journal, Easter holidays were more dramatic for US President Donald Trump than previously known.

During a rescue mission involving two American service members in Iran, the president was reportedly not fully briefed by his advisers on purpose.

Instead, according to US media reports, they kept Trump away from the relevant crisis meeting because his impatience would not have been helpful.

The Wall Street Journal writes, citing a person familiar with the events, that Trump was only informed at key moments.

However, Trump allegedly began shouting, which lasted for hours, at his advisers after learning about the downing of a US fighter jet.

He was reportedly concerned that the soldiers might fall into Iranian hands and suffer a fate similar to that during the presidency of Jimmy Carter, when in 1979 the US embassy in Tehran was attacked and many Americans were taken hostage.

A US F-15E fighter jet was reportedly shot down in early April. One pilot was rescued relatively quickly, while the second crew member was later found in what Trump described as “one of the most daring search-and-rescue military operations in US history.”

Much of the operation reportedly involved diversionary maneuvers at different locations, while the injured officer, who was heavily bleeding, climbed steep cliffs.

While treating his own wounds, he managed to contact US forces. His rescue followed a “life-and-death race” between American and Iranian forces, the New York Times cited US officials as saying.

More than 150 aircraft were reportedly involved in the operation.

After the second F-15E crew member was rescued, Trump wrote that the fact both operations were carried out “without a single American killed or even injured” again proved “overwhelming air superiority.”
